Serendipity 'Language-Specific HTML Nugget' Plug-in by Wesley Hwang-Chung, version 1.1 This plug-in acts exactly like the default HTML Nugget plug-in, with one exception - you can choose under what language the HTML nugget will be visible in. For example, if you choose 'Korean', the HTML nugget will be visible only if the blog is being viewed under 'Korean' language option (generally using the Multilingual plug-in). This plug-in is useful in multilingual blogs where the author wants to display different HTML nuggets specifically tied to a language. History 1.4: Added support for three new languages in s9y 0.9 1.1: Initial Release
